Air Pollution and Health About 5 million people die every year because of poor air quality. This burden falls disproportionately on women and children living without access to clean household energy, and people living in low- and middle-income countries where urbanization has brought increased emissions. Vital Strategies provides technical expertise and consultative services to inform policies and influence public discourse about air pollution and its health impacts around the world.
Childhood Lead Poisoning Prevention As many as 800 million children globally have unsafe blood lead levels according to the World Health Organization. Vital Strategies’ Childhood Lead Poisoning Prevention program was launched with the government of Peru to support ongoing lead poisoning surveillance, raise public awareness about key sources of lead exposure, and improve regulation of lead in consumer products. The program recently expanded to Indonesia where we are partnering with UNICEF and Pure Earth to update the nation’s clinical guidance for lead exposure in children and conduct a comprehensive assessment of lead policies and stakeholders.

Tobacco Control Vital Strategies is a partner in the Bloomberg Initiative to Reduce Tobacco Use. We work with governments and civil society organizations to implement proven policies like those in the World Health Organization’s international health treaty, the Framework Convention on Tobacco Control, and in the MPOWER package of tobacco reduction measures. Our work has spanned over 50 low- and middle-income countries, where 80% of tobacco deaths occur.
